“Social Enterprise” explained….
Social Enterprises are businesses that use surpluses to directly support their communities rather than give profits to share holders. There are over 150 such bussiness in Norfolk and 62,000 across the UK. A well known social enterprise is Jamie Oliver’s Fifteen; a restaurant which provides training and work experience for young people disadvantaged in the labour market.
